4. Conclusion

Integration is a key concept in logistics, and the bearer of an organizational myth: the integrated supply chain, which implies a strong adaptation of its components.

Analysis of supply chain integration reveals dimensions that are often underestimated in logistics integration projects. In addition to the traditional technical aspects of integrating processes, systems (particularly information systems) and technologies, the organizational and human dimensions are crucial. The congruence of "logistics" and "strategic" visions is also decisive.

We propose to adopt a differentiated vision of integration, and our article has proposed reading grids along these lines.
